We are seeking an Analytical Scientist I for our Cell Therapy Manufacturing Facility located Memphis, TN.

 

The Analytical Scientist I will provide analytical technical support for incoming technology transfers of client test methods for advanced cell therapies. This role will participate in the analytical transfer process and will ensure that the knowledge transfer to QC and supporting groups is efficient and effective. This role will also be involved in QC method preparation, execution, method qualification / validation, and close out of technology transfer activities. The following are responsibilities related to the Analytical Scientist I:

 

•    Work as part of a cross-functional transfer team to ensure maximum and high-quality output of deliverables for clients.

•    Assess client QC testing requirements against internal capabilities and experience to identify any testing and / or raw material gaps.

•    Identify any gap or technical mitigations to high-risk items and present to leadership for endorsement.

•    Provide laboratory support and troubleshooting for QC and supporting groups to ensure transfer of testing knowledge was effective.

•    Monitor and analyze transferred test method performance (QC) and troubleshoot technical difficulties as needed.

•    Provide support for investigations and impact assessment.

•    Ensures tasks are performed in a manner consistent with safety standards and within cGMP guidelines.

•    Assist in expanding analytical knowledge, controls for analytical transfer consistency, and continuous improvement.

•    Receives occasional guidance from supervisor regarding planning activities, assigned deliverables, and timelines.

•    Generate documentation supporting tech transfer and production and provide technical support.

•    Travel may be required for training or analytical transfer activities. Job Qualifications  

The following are minimum qualifications related to the Analytical Scientist I position:

•    BS with 2+ years/ MS with 1+ year/ PhD with 1 year of relevant experience.

•    Established analytical skills and knowledge of cell culture and working knowledge of cGMP.

•    Experience with analytical assays including, but not limited to: Assay Design Assay Implementation Assay Troubleshooting

•    Detail oriented with good organizational skills.

•    Effective written and oral communication skills.

•    High degree of professionalism and confidentiality.

•    Take the initiative to remain apprised of relevant industry and regulatory trends.

•    Assertive, showing willingness to gain industry knowledge.

About Biologics Testing Solutions

With more than 50 years of experience and proven regulatory expertise, the Charles River Biologics group can address challenging projects for biotechnology and pharmaceutical companies worldwide. Offering a variety of services such as contamination and impurity testing, protein characterization, bioassays, viral clearance studies and stability and lot release programs, we support clients throughout the biologic development cycle, from the establishment and characterization of cell banks through preclinical and clinical studies to marketed products. Whether clients need stand-alone services, a unique package of testing, or insourced support, our Biologics group can create a custom solution to suit their needs.  Each year more than 20,000 biologic testing reports are sent each and over 200 licenses products are supported by our biologics testing solutions team.

About Charles River

Charles River is an early-stage contract research organization (CRO). We have built upon our foundation of laboratory animal medicine and science to develop a diverse portfolio of discovery and safety assessment services, both Good Laboratory Practice (GLP) and non-GLP, to support clients from target identification through preclinical development. Charles River also provides a suite of products and services to support our clients’ clinical laboratory testing needs and manufacturing activities. Utilizing this broad portfolio of products and services enables our clients to create a more flexible drug development model, which reduces their costs, enhances their productivity and effectiveness to increase speed to market.

With over 20,000 employees within 110 facilities in over 20 countries around the globe, we are strategically positioned to coordinate worldwide resources and apply multidisciplinary perspectives in resolving our client’s unique challenges. Our client base includes global p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ology companies, government agencies and hospitals and academic institutions around the world.
